In this classic interview, the late composer talks on topics such as his love of nature and his fervent Christian faith, two themes that profoundly shaped his work; his views on rhythm and tonal color; his relationship with his mother, the poet Cécile Sauvage; and his professorship at the Paris Conservatoire. Film clips of Messiaen improvising on the organ and notating birdsong for his compositions—plus excerpts of his music, some of which are performed by his wife, the celebrated pianist Yvonne Loriod—provide a deeper appreciation of his special genius. The first performance of the work was in 1970 at the Guggenheim Museum in New York. In collaboration with his partner Mary Lucier. The piece features Lucier recording himself narrating a text, and then playing the tape recording back into the room while re-recording it. The new recording is then played back and re-recorded, and this process is repeated. Due to the room's particular size and geometry, certain resonant frequencies are emphasized while others are attenuated. Eventually the words become unintelligible, replaced by the characteristic resonance of the room.",0.6256,"\u002F53Bp2pfTERNigN5cpvhzJFRbYCq.jpg","1970-10-12",{"adult":8,"backdrop_path":62,"genre_ids":63,"id":65,"title":66,"original_language":21,"original_title":66,"overview":67,"popularity":68,"poster_path":69,"release_date":70,"softcore":8,"video":35,"vote_average":71,"vote_count":52},"\u002FmVZASS7IzCWmwEZRvawI3JgjBh0.jpg",[64,13],14,455824,"The Metropolitan Opera: The Exterminating Angel","After the acclaimed Met premiere of Thomas Adès's \"The Tempest\" in 2012, the composer returned with another masterpiece, this time inspired by filmmaker Luis Buñuel's seminal surrealist classic \"El Ángel Exterminador\", during the 2017–18 season. However, it was banned by the communist committee tasked with judging the performance from “a politically correct” point of view. The committee claimed that Radok’s manners and morals were behind the times, and that the director did not show the ultra-modern techniques of Czechoslovakian agriculture. The premiere was postponed and Radok was fired from the Laterna Magika Theatre. His young colleagues (including Milos Forman) were officially asked to finish the rehearsals without the controversial part, and to make other minor changes in other scenes (these changes were made). Alfred Radok considered this to an unforgivable betrayal, as he expected them to leave the theatre to support him.",0.3064,"1966-01-01",7,{"adult":8,"backdrop_path":9,"genre_ids":170,"id":171,"title":172,"original_language":21,"original_title":172,"overview":173,"popularity":174,"poster_path":175,"release_date":176,"softcore":8,"video":8,"vote_average":10,"vote_count":10},[16],724713,"Hail Bop! Lucier explains and comments on his œuvre – from his early live electronics performances (MUSIC FOR SOLO PERFORMER,1965 and BIRD AND PERSON DYNING, 1975) up to the premiere of his ensemble piece PANORAMA 2 in 2011. One of Lucier’s key works, I AM SITTING IN A ROOM (1969), is introduced as a central structuring device in the film.  At home in Middletown, Connecticut, Lucier offers rare insights into the beginnings of his pioneering works, his time as a member of the Sonic Arts Union, his relations with John Cage and David Tudor, as well as his teaching practice at Wesleyan University.",1.3329,"\u002Fx6EShxSOFp3XlCIEqOXUjeLKPoC.jpg","2012-03-23",{"adult":8,"backdrop_path":214,"genre_ids":215,"id":216,"title":217,"original_language":21,"original_title":217,"overview":218,"popularity":219,"poster_path":220,"release_date":221,"softcore":8,"video":35,"vote_average":102,"vote_count":40},"\u002FjdUyZEoiAMlmnhUPqIrdD4gouVx.jpg",[13],543705,"The Metropolitan Opera: Marnie","Composer Nico Muhly unveils his second new opera for the Met with this gripping reimagining of Winston Graham’s novel, set in the 1950s, about a beautiful, mysterious young woman who assumes multiple identities.
